Default Making it possible for Sims to play in leaf piles on community lots
I've got a problem where I need to record a video of one of my Sims playing in leaf piles on a community lot. However, the option to play in the leaf piles wouldn't appear. So I was forced to convert the community lot into a residential lot. Problem solved, right? Nope. One of the other Sims who I plan to use as a background Sim no longer has the option to barbeque hot dogs without a counter. And I can't allow her to use a counter to make the hot dogs offscreen. Because then it will be obvious that the lot is no longer a community lot.

Even converting the lot to a resort doesn't help. As the 'play in' interactions are just automatically cancelled from the interaction queue upon hitting the play button.
